Sinner Reaches China Open Final After De Minaur Win
Jannik Sinner beat Alex de Minaur 6-3, 4-6, 6-2 in Beijing to reach his third straight China Open final. He will face the winner of the semi between 19-year-old Learner Tien and former US Open champion Daniil Medvedev for the title. The victory capped a week that included a comeback over Fabian Marozsan and a gritty 6-4, 5-7, 6-0 escape against Terence Atmane, underscoring his resilience in tight, physical matches. The China Open is Sinner’s first event since he lost the US Open final to Carlos Alcaraz on Sept. 7, a defeat that cost him the world No. 1 ranking. Meanwhile, World No. 1 Carlos Alcaraz beat Zizou Bergs 6-4, 6-3 to reach the Japan Open quarterfinals and will face Brandon Nakashima.
